Speaking of Front Plate Brackets, anyone have the Altec Retractable Show-N-Go Plate Bracket on a 2010 V6 or GT ??
They make both manual AND motorized versions ... seen plenty of pics & videos of them on 2005-2009, but not on a 2010.
The 2010-11 V6 has a small black chin spoiler along the lower edge of the bumper cover (GT has something similar) so just wondering how it fits / works on these cars.
Tried to find a mfr. page to this product to link to, but all I could find were vendors sites (american muscle, ninosport, etc).
For all of you that DO have this product (any year or make car), how durable is it ... can it handle year-round daily driver use in snow & ice, rain, etc and 20k+ miles a year at 75 MPH ??
